Location, stay context, and what to verify

Before you finalize any stay linked to gajanan maharaj bhakt niwas trimbakeshwar, verify four practical points.

1. Exact location

Trimbakeshwar is a pilgrimage destination where “near temple” can mean different walking or driving distances. Ask for the exact landmark, not just the area name.

2. Room suitability

A couple, a family of five, and a senior-citizen group need different room arrangements. Confirm bed count, floor access, washroom type, and check-in flexibility.

3. Booking method

Some devotees prefer phone confirmation; others want an online path. If a digital booking route is available, check whether it is official, current, and matches your dates.

4. Peak-season rules

Temple towns often apply stricter check-in policies during festivals. ID requirements, timing windows, and cancellation flexibility may change during heavy footfall [source: hospitality operations studies].

How to plan your stay step by step

If your goal is action, use this simple process.

Step-by-step booking approach

  1. Fix your travel date first. Weekend and festival demand is usually much higher than weekday demand.
  2. Estimate group size accurately. Count adults, children, and any senior citizens who may need ground-floor or lift access.
  3. Verify the exact Bhakt Niwas name and location. Similar-sounding references can confuse first-time visitors.
  4. Confirm room availability before travel. Do not assume walk-in rooms will be available during peak periods.
  5. Ask about required ID and check-in timing. This avoids delays after a long journey.
  6. Reconfirm one day before arrival. This is especially useful if you are arriving late at night or early morning.

Pros and cons of staying in a Bhakt Niwas

For many devotees, a Bhakt Niwas is the right choice. But not always.

Pros

  • Usually aligned with pilgrimage needs rather than luxury travel
  • Often more practical for early darshan schedules
  • Better suited to families and devotional groups
  • Can feel calmer than general commercial stays in busy temple areas

Cons

  • Facilities may be simpler than hotels
  • Room availability can tighten quickly in peak season
  • Policies may be stricter on ID, timing, or occupancy
  • Not every property suits travelers needing premium amenities

When to use vs avoid

Choose a Bhakt Niwas if your priority is darshan convenience, basic comfort, and a devotional environment. Avoid relying on it blindly if your trip depends on premium business-style amenities, highly flexible check-in, or guaranteed last-minute availability.
